Post Idea for a playerworld, wondering if it seems viable..?

I had a new idea for a server that will be set in the classic/medieval age, and utilize fantasy aspects as well. I would be kidding myself and everyone else if I said I had any of the Development skills to create a server, but I would not mind funding one or handling the administration side of things,
Setting- This server is a Medieval server with many aspects, most importantly magic and spells. It is a largely unexplored and unsettled world with the exception of one main island and a few outlying settlements and tribal villages. There are no guns, cars, land mines, x-ray goggles, or anything of that nature.

Weapons/Battling- Typical weapons include swords, daggers, spears, and maces as melee weapons with bows and arrows, crossbows, and javelins being used for ranged attacks. Spells can include attack spells, defense spells, healing spells, and spells that alter the environment slightly. Weapons and spells will be loosely tied to a players class/specialty.

Classes/Specialties-
Rather than having a rigid class structure (mages get certain spells, fighters and thieves get certain weapons, etc.) this server will have its players based more loosely on their chosen class and job specialty, and allow players to change this over time without having to completely reset their account and start over. Their initially chosen class and job specialty will give them bonuses in certain aspects of gameplay, but they will still be able to use the other weapons and spells, and through studying and training can switch classes and get better at other aspects of the game.

Economy- The economy will be largely controlled by the players, as it will be up to them to gather resources, create basic and advanced items, and set the prices for these items. Staff will oversee everything to make sure that things don’t get out of hand and that the economy remains fair and balanced, but generally prices for things will not be decided on by the staff.

The Overworld-
All players will start on a main island with a few cities as well as several places to gather resources and battle with both each other and NPC enemies. The main island will provide all the means necessary for players to gather all of the game’s resources, craft weapons, and purchase their own apartments to store items and money in. There will be a separate island for events that will be detached from the over world and will also feature a Spar/PK arena. The rest of the over world, as referenced before, will be largely uninhabited save a few small settlements and NPC tribes.

Towns/Cities- Rather than having an entire server filled with pre-built cities, this server will allow players with enough resources to venture out from the main island and create towns, cities, and even nations of their own. They will be able to apply resources such as stone and lumber to create buildings, use food that they harvest or catch to feed their members, and craft weapons and tools with metal. Initially the buildings will have default insides that have been predetermined by the staff, but as towns and nations become more established (certain number of time or active players, perhaps) custom levels can be uploaded. In order to prevent everyone from having their own nation and town to themselves, their will be certain guidelines that must be attained (5-10 players for village, 15+ for nation, X amount of resources, etc.) before a new village or nation can be created.

Role Playing- I believe that the player-controlled economy, loose class system, and custom cities and nations will allow for a more free-form RP experience, rather than having the players told which nations they can join and who is at war with whom and which classes get which weapons right from the start. The staff will be there every step of the way to make sure that everything is balanced, host fun events , and introduce special Role Playing events from time to time. They will also be there to expand the Overworld as necessary to accommodate newly formed nations, as well as update the current Overworld and city levels to keep things from getting old and boring.
